POSITION SPECIFICS

The Electro-Optics & Electronics (EOE) Division of the Applied Research Laboratory (ARL) at Penn State University, located in Freeport PA, is seeking a senior-level, Manufacturing Technology Engineer.  The purpose of Penn State ARL is to develop innovative solutions to challenging national problems in support of the Navy, Department of Defense (DoD), and intelligence communities. You will join a team of scientists and engineers performing a wide range of applied research and development projects involving electronics manufacturing process improvements.

ARL is authorized DoD SkillBridge partner and welcomes all transitioning military members to apply.

You will:

  • Develop manufacturing improvements to produce DoD systems

  • Execute research and development projects in manufacturing technology engineering

  • Plan and manage concurrent project tasks to achieve research contract goals

  • Collaborate with other engineers, scientists, technical and program staff including the Penn State ARL research team, Penn State ARL faculty at Penn State, DoD laboratories, DoD program offices and related industry teams to accomplish project and organizational goals

  • Prepare and present your work as briefings and reports to a variety of audiences

Required skills and experience includes:

  • No less than 10 years of relevant experience electronics manufacturing technologies for components and systems

  • Ability to clearly communicate, document, and present results

  • Work independently and as part of a multidisciplinary team that includes technical and program management roles

  • Eligibility for Secret Clearance

Preferred skills and experience includes:

  • Experience with development, production and test of radar, electronic warfare and similar systems at the system / architecture level including identification and implementation of novel solutions in DoD electronics manufacturing

  • Experience with project management practice in a research project leadership role that involves execution and development of multiple related project efforts

  • An advanced technical degree relevant to electronic systems

  • Experience with lean manufacturing concepts

  • An active Secret security clearance with eligibility for TS/SCI

About Penn State University

The Applied Research Laboratory at Penn State University is an integral part of one of the leading research universities in the nation. ARL-Penn State supports national security, economic competitiveness, and quality of life through Education; Scientific discovery; Technology demonstration; and Transition to application. As a designated University Affiliated Research Center (UARC), ARL-Penn State conducts essential research, development, and systems engineering in support of our nations priorities free from conflict of interest or competition with commercial industry.
